Abstract
The utility model belongs to the technical field of the cooling tower technique and specifically relates to an industry dust catcher is related to, including gas outlet, air inlet, pipeline, dust collection head, solid -liquid separation board, liquid filter and wheel, the gas outlet sets up on the dust catcher top, and inlet set is at dust catcher organism outer peripheral surface, and the wheel setting is in the dust catcher bottom, solid -liquid separation board surface evenly sets up a plurality of magnet to a plurality of separation hole have been dug, a plurality of filtration pores of crossing have been dug on liquid filter surface, have realized energy -concerving and environment -protectively, and the clearance thoroughly to can the work of unifying, improve work efficiency.
Description
Technical field
This utility model relates to field of environment protection equipment, is specifically related to a kind of industry vacuum cleaner.
Background technology
Industrial dust collector is a kind of equipment conventional in industry, in industrial processes, collect garbage, filter and purify air, carry out environmental cleanup, it is largely used to weaving and chemical industry, the harm of some occupation disease can be prevented, China's industrial development is swift and violent at present, annual industrial output value is all constantly increasing, therefore the demand of personnel is also being continuously increased, but this equipment needs manual site to operate, bigger for plant area, needing to expend the substantial amounts of muscle power of workman, work efficiency is the highest.
Utility model content
The purpose of this utility model is to provide a kind of industry vacuum cleaner, reaches to clear up technical problem thoroughly.
Technical solution of the present utility model is as follows:
A kind of industry vacuum cleaner, including gas outlet, air inlet, pipeline, cleaner head, solid-liquid separation plate, liquid screen plate and wheel;Described gas outlet is arranged on vacuum cleaner top, and air inlet is arranged on vacuum cleaner body external peripheral surface, and wheel is arranged on vacuum cleaner bottom;Described solid-liquid separation plate surface is uniformly arranged multiple Magnet, and has dug multiple sorting hole;Described liquid filter surface has dug multiple filtering holes.
Further, described air inlet and cleaner head are connected by pipeline.
Further, the diameter of described sorting hole is more than filtering holes, and quantity is less than filtering holes.
Relative to prior art, a kind of industry vacuum cleaner described in the utility model has the advantage that
This utility model provide industrial vacuum cleaner can realize solid-liquid separation, and energy-conserving and environment-protective, the filtering holes aperture of liquid filter surface is 0.1mm, sewage directly can be processed, water purification in liquid screen plate underlying space can be collected as water purification cleaning recycling, not only increase work efficiency, also achieve the beneficial effect of energy-saving and emission-reduction.
